Selling your home is a big move—emotionally and financially. If you’re wondering why hire a real estate agent when selling, you’re not alone. Many homeowners consider going the “For Sale By Owner” (FSBO) route, hoping to save on commission. But what you save in fees could cost you more in missed opportunities, legal issues, and lost time.
In this blog, we’ll dive into the top 5 reasons why hiring a real estate agent when selling your home can make all the difference—and why going it alone might not be worth the gamble.
- 🎯 Strategic Market Expertise: Sell Smarter, Not Harder
Understand Local Market Dynamics
A seasoned real estate agent doesn’t just know the general housing market—they’re immersed in your local real estate trends. From knowing what buyers are looking for to timing your listing perfectly, they’re experts at selling in your zip code.
Price It Right the First Time
Using a Comparative Market Analysis (CMA), agents recommend a competitive asking price based on nearby sales, market conditions, and your home’s unique features. This ensures your listing stands out—and doesn’t linger.

- 📍 Local Knowledge You Can’t Google
Real estate agents offer more than just general insights—they know the specific school districts, upcoming developments, and buyer preferences in your neighborhood. Their network also gives them access to off-market buyers and insider info.

- 💰 Master the Pricing Game
Setting the right price is crucial. Too high? You scare away buyers. Too low? You leave money on the table. Real estate agents use the latest tools, including MLS access and market trends, to price your home accurately.

- 📄 Navigate Complex Paperwork and Legalities
Selling involves a mountain of forms—from listing agreements to mandatory disclosures. A missed signature or misstep could cost you the deal—or worse, land you in legal trouble.
Agents help manage:
Contracts
Disclosures
Contingency timelines
Escrow coordination

- 🧠 Powerful Negotiation Skills
Once offers come in, the real work begins. A skilled agent negotiates:
Price
Repairs and concessions
Timeline adjustments
Agents protect your interests while keeping deals on track—even when buyers get cold feet or inspectors find issues.
